Wrought in God

John 3:21 (NASB) 21“But he who practices the truth comes to the Light, so that his deeds may be manifested as having been wrought in God.”

These three words, "wrought in God" have been ringing in my spirit for months. The focus of the above scripture is not the first part of the scripture but the last. You see, the one who practices the truth and comes to the Light is a natural result of having something "wrought in God" within them. This is the key: Surrendering to the Holy Spirit and allowing Him to form Christ within us. This definately sounds more glorious in word than it feels in action. It is a place of death and agony. But the beautiful result is the image of Jesus Christ being brought into a clearer view within our lives. Then, and only then, our lives will follow the pattern of Christ's as He is manifested through the very things we do. We will feel a drawing in our spirit to come more and more into the light of His presence so that all things will be revealed as having been "wrought in God".
